987940681309 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 987940681310. Its totient is φ = 987940681308.

The previous prime is 987940681261. The next prime is 987940681327. The reversal of 987940681309 is 903186049789.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 623788778809 + 364151902500 = 789803^2 + 603450^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 987940681309 - 27 = 987940681181 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×9879406813092 (a number of 25 digits) contains 22 as substring.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(987940684309)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 493970340654 + 493970340655.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(493970340655).

Almost surely, 2987940681309 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

987940681309 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

987940681309 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

987940681309 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 23514624, while the sum is 64.
